Abstract

Bourletiellidae (Symphypleona, Appendiciphora, Sminthuroidea) comprises several genera exclusively distributed across tropical and subtropical regions worldwide. Adisianus Bretfeld, a genus within this family, is found in the Neotropical Region and currently includes only three species described from forested areas in Brazil and Mexico. Here we revisit the genus describing a new species, Adisianus pinheadi sp. nov., from a transitional area between the Cerrado and Caatinga biomes in the Northeastern region of Brazil. The new species is more similar to A. fuscus (Bretfeld) and A. maculatus (Bretfeld) in the presence of rough blunt spine-like chaetae on antennae, dorsal head and large abdomen, but it is unique in the combination of its color pattern, antennal and head chaetotaxy, and number of chaetae on manubrium and tenaculum. We also update the diagnosis of the genus, provide an identification key to its species, and discuss its similarities with the Sphyrothecinae (Sminthuridae), along with the potential implications for the internal relationships within Symphypleona.
